a side believed to be stuck inside the base i managed to. touch. at 4 30 pm everything set for the record run. the i.d.r. is powered by 2 electric motors with a system performance of $500.00 kilowatts overall the the research car including driver weighs about 1100 kilograms the current record for all electric vehicles are 6 minutes and 45.9 seconds that corresponds to an average speed of almost 185 kilometers per hour the record was set by britain's peter dunne break at the wheel of n n a o e p 9 in 2017. tense moments for the monitors really come in under the timing. the pit crew are also hoping for the best. but behind the wheel a man dumas keeps

the oldest vehicle in this year's rally is a 1923 bentley 3 leaders speed model this british jewel of the jazz age purrs along the alpine roads was 60 kilowatts and no problems at all. the recent clues various time controls and extra special stages that demand the utmost from the participants and their cars everyone has to be prepared for the worst mishaps and breakdowns are all but inevitable this time it hits this triumph roadster. yet at least it had to grow sever mean a cold which is at a loss as to the problem source. smoke is coming from under the steering wheel fortunately experience vintage car buffs are on hand and willing to help or give or a lift the problem turns out to be a burning cable and. the rally is a mobile review of automotive history $170.00 vehicles made between
1:50 am
10231975 including $24.00 pre world war 2 rarities add up to an unequalled spectacle. there are impressive pre-war model race cars pricey sports cars limousines and coo pages from the 1950 s. and sixty's and production model passenger cars from each of the 6 decades represented here. added together all the vehicles entered in this year's alpine rally would be worth $30.00 to $40000000.00 euros and a conservative estimate. is a lot of fun this is my 2nd year here and we came from. the united states for ginia
